Bitcoin has lost more than 20% in value over the past two days. The cryptocurrency is currently trading at $ 59,817 (around Rs. 44.6 lakh) with a 1.24% gain on Indian exchange CoinSwitch. On the international exchange CoinMarketCap, the first cryptocurrency is valued at $ 58,000 (around Rs. 43 lakh). This current Bitcoin situation contrasts sharply with what it was a few days ago when the token was hovering around its all-time high of $ 68,327.99 (around Rs. 50.5 lakh). The crypto market collapsed earlier this week after India’s proposal to ban “private cryptocurrencies” was put on Parliament’s agenda.
Ether managed to break free from the negative market period earlier than Bitcoin. With a gain of 3.85%, Ether entered trading on Friday, November 26 at $ 4,573 (around Rs. 3.4 lakh), according to crypto price tracker Gadgets 360. Earlier this month, Ether had also set a new all-time high for trading at $ 4,811 (around Rs. 3.5 lakh).
The green color that dominates the crypto price chart today indicates that the majority of popular cryptocurrencies including Tether, Ripple, USDCoin, and Dogecoin have seen increases in their trade values.
On the other hand, some tokens like Cardano, Polkadot and Shiba Inu registered marginal declines.
India is preparing to bring the subject of cryptography to the parliamentary table in the coming days. For now, the country is considering banning all “private cryptocurrencies” without specifying the definition of the term.
Also, the risks that cryptocurrencies are likely to have become a matter of contention among enthusiasts. Recently, after the FBI warned people about the increase in crypto scams, the Shiba Inu team informed investors of a tricked-out scam circling Telegram.
Tesla CEO Elon Musk also backed an idea on Twitter that prompts investors to keep their crypto assets in private wallets rather than keeping their custody at centralized exchanges like Binance and Robinhood.
